REVERSIBLE PILLOW AND STORAGE DEVICE
A reversible pillow having a first panel with a seam located around its perimeter. A first flap is attached to a portion of the first panel at the seam. A second flap is attached to another portion of the first panel at the seam. The second flap is overlapping with the first flap. The panel, the first flap and the second flap are attached to each other to define a first storage compartment. A fastener is attached to the pair of flaps adapted to secure the flaps closed over the first storage compartment. The reversible pillow is adapted to switch between: a first position, in which the pair of flaps overlap to cover the storage compartment, and a second position, reversed from the first position, in which the first panel and the pair of flaps are turned inside-out defining a second storage compartment.
REMOVABLE (AND OPTIONALLY WASHABLE) HAT INSERT FOR ABSORBING PERSPIRATION
The challenge of protecting caps from excess perspiration is solved by providing a hat liner comprising: (a) a first portion including a plurality of tabs separated by one or more gaps, the first portion dimensioned so that at least a part of it fits between, and is held by, the sweatband of a cap and one or more front panels of a hat; and (b) a second portion, directly or indirectly joined with the first portion along a length, and including at least one moisture absorbing layer. The second potion may further include at least one moisture wicking layer. The first portion may include at least three tabs defined and separated by at least two gaps. At least some of the two gaps may have a wider open end and a narrower closed end. Each of the plurality of tabs in the first potion may be provided with a plurality of lateral ridges. The second portion may be indirectly joined with the first portion via the hinge portion. The hinge portion is provided with a plurality of lateral slits.
Hard hat with filtered, battery-operated air flow system and method
A hard hat with air flow system includes a hard hat with an air flow passage for passing air through the hard hat and out exits ports at the front of the hat to provide a shield of air downward across the face of a user. The system includes an air filtration system, a blower assembly for drawing air through the air filter and pushing the filtered air into the air flow passage of the hard hat, and a power supply for powering the blower. The filtration system, blower assembly and power supply being supported on a harness such as a belt or backpack, external from the hard hat.
Scalp Cooling Apparatus, Method, and System
A scalp cooling apparatus, method, and system that may include an inner scalp cap, an intermediate scalp covering, and an outer scalp cap. The inner scalp cap may be fluidly coupled to a cooling device, that would allow a cooling fluid to traverse the fluid chambers within a set of sections of the inner scalp cap. The inner scalp covering can be constructed of a thermally conductive material. The intermediate scalp covering can be constructed of a thermally neutral material. The outer scalp covering can be constructed of a thermally resistant material. The outer scalp covering may have a first securing mechanism, and a second securing mechanism, that allow the outer scalp covering to be dynamically adjusted and secured against a patient's scalp via the first securing mechanism and the second securing mechanism. The inner scalp cap may be created from a scan of a patient's head, that can then be utilized as an interpolated parametric model may be utilized to generate an output file.
Wall Holder for Display of Baseball-type Cap
A wall mounted baseball-style cap holder (or cap clip) that supports the cap the apex of its crown proximate a button (if the cap is so equipped) is described. The clip comprises a base plate including a flat rear surface, which may have a layer of pressure sensitive adhesive attached thereto, and upper and lower spaced arcuate plate-like protrusions that extend generally orthogonally from the base plate. The holder is configured to be mounted to a wall or other substantially vertical surface typically by way of an adhesive or double sided tape, which may or may not be provided with the holder.

INFRARED RADIATION TRANSPARENT SUBSTRATES AND SYSTEMS AND METHODS FOR CREATION AND USE THEREOF
Substrates with transparency to infrared body radiation and opacity in the visible light spectrum are provided and systems and methods for creation thereof are provided. The IR radiation transparent substrate is IR radiation transparent and visible light opaque with enough breathability and softness to make it suitable for use in garments for body thermal regulation. Further, the IR radiation transparent substrate is created utilizing nanofiber technology to form specific sized micro pores between the nanofibers.
Methods and apparatus for a head covering device with increased air circulation
Methods and apparatus for a head covering may improve air circulation through any suitable head covering. Methods and apparatus for a head covering may comprise a base configured to fit around a wearer's head, a sidewall comprising a plurality of open cells configured to prevent light rays at or above a predetermined angle relative to the passageway of each cell from passing unobstructed through the cell, and a crown configured to close of the interior surface of the sidewall. The minimum depth of each cell may be determined based on the height of the cell, the angle at or above which the light rays are to obstructed, and the angle of the exterior cell opening. The cells may be arranged in the sidewall such that the lower surface of the passageway of each cell is substantially at the same angle with respect to a horizontal plane.

FOOTWEAR PLATE
A method of forming a plate for an article of footwear is disclosed. The method includes applying a first strand portion to a base layer including positioning adjacent segments of the first strand portion to form a first layer on the base layer. The adjacent segments of the first strand portion having a greater density across a width of the plate between a medial side and a lateral side at a midfoot region of the plate than at a forefoot region of the plate and at a heel region of the plate. The method also includes applying at least one of heat and pressure to the first strand portion and to the base layer to conform the first strand portion and the base layer to a predetermined shape.
